首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
在窗体上画一个文本框,名称为Textl(可显示多行),然后再画三个命令按钮,名称分别为Commandl、Command2和Command3,标题分别为”读数”、”统计”和”存盘”,如图2.5所示。程序的其功能是:单击”读数”按钮,则把考生目录下的in5.t
在窗体上画一个文本框,名称为Textl(可显示多行),然后再画三个命令按钮,名称分别为Commandl、Command2和Command3,标题分别为”读数”、”统计”和”存盘”,如图2.5所示。程序的其功能是:单击”读数”按钮,则把考生目录下的in5.t
admin
2013-10-06
56
问题
在窗体上画一个文本框,名称为Textl(可显示多行),然后再画三个命令按钮,名称分别为Commandl、Command2和Command3,标题分别为”读数”、”统计”和”存盘”,如图2.5所示。程序的其功能是:单击”读数”按钮,则把考生目录下的in5.txt文件中的所有英文字符放入Textl(可多行显示);单击”统计”按钮,找出并统计英文字母i、j、k、l、m、n(不区分大小写)各自出现的次数;单击”存盘”按钮,将字母i~n出现次数的统计结果依次存到考生目录下的顺序文件out5.st中。
注意:存盘时必须存放在考生文件夹下,工程文件名为sjt5.vbp,窗体文件名为sjt5.frm。
选项
答案
步骤1:新建一个”标准EXE”工程,如表3-4在窗体中画出控件并设置其相关属性。 [*] 步骤2:打开代码编辑窗口,编写相应事件过程。 参考代码: Option Base 1 Dim sum(6) As Integer Prirate Sub Command:C1ick( ) Open App.Path&”\in5.txt”For Input As#1 Text1.Text=Input(LOF(1),#1) Close#1 End Sub Private Sub Command2 C1ick( ) For i=1 To 6 sum(i)=0 Next i If Len(Textl.Text)=0 Then NsgBox”请先使用_”读数”_功能!” Else For i=1 To Len(Textl.Text) c=LCase(Mid(Textl.Text,i,1)) Select Case c Case”i” SUm(1)=Sum(1)+1 Case”j” Sum(2)=sum(2)+1 Case”k” sum(3)=sum(3)+1 Case”1” sum(4)=sum(4)+1 Case”m” sum(5):sum(5)+1 Case”n” sum(6)=sum(6)+1 End Select Next i End If End Sub Private Sub Command3 C1ick( ) Open App.Path&”\out5.txt”For Output As#1 For i=1 To 6 Print #1,sum(i) Next i Close #1 End Sub 步骤3:按要求将文件保存至考生文件夹中。
解析
转载请注明原文地址:https://www.kaotiyun.com/show/zhQp777K
本试题收录于:
二级VB题库NCRE全国计算机二级分类
0
二级VB
NCRE全国计算机二级
相关试题推荐
在窗体上画一个名称为CommonDialog1的通用对话框和一个名为Command1的命令按钮。要求实现这样一个功能:单击命令按钮后,打开一个通用对话框用于保存文件,其窗口标题为“保存”,默认文件名为Data,在“文件类型”栏中显示*.txt。下列程序中能
下列程序段的执行结果为______。DimnAsIntegern=10Whilen<>0n=n-1WendPrint"n=";n
单击一次命令按钮之后,窗体中的输出结果为______。PrivateSubCommand1_Click()DimaAsInteger,bAsIntegerFori=1To6
单击一次命令按钮之后,在对话框中输入12,2,34,23,窗体中的输出结果为______。PrivateSubCommand1_Click()Dima(4)AsIntegerFori=1To4
在窗体上画一个名为Command1的命令按钮和一个名为Text1的文本框,并把窗体的KeyPreview属性设置为True,然后编写如下代码:DimSaveAllAsStringPrivateSubForm_Load()
在窗体上画一个名称为Text1的文本框和名称为HScrolll的水平滚动条(Max属性为10,Min属性为0),然后画两个标题分别为“慢”和“快”的标签。程序运行后,移动滚动块,如果滚动块位于滚动条的正中间位置,则在文本框中显示“适中”;如果滚动块位于滚
在数据结构的图形结构中,每个结点的前驱结点数和后续结点数可以有【】个。
在运行过程中,要将某窗体设置为不可见,可以设置窗体的______属性。
深度为5的满二叉树有【】个叶子结点。
随机试题
Actingissuchanover-crowdedprofessionthattheonlyadvicethatshouldbegiventoayoungpersonthinkingofgoingonthes
杆菌肽敏感试验阳性为
在风险管理实践中,为了对不确定性收益进行计量和评估,通常需要计算未来的()。
需求量的变动是指()。
已知向量a=2i+3j-k,b=-i+j-2k,c=2ma一3ab,若c⊥x轴,则m=________.(用n表示)
下列关于奉献社会的说法,正确的有()。
不少父母在养育和教育孩子时,容易忽视孩子心理与行为发展的顺序渐进或个性需要,急切期望按照社会的模子去“克隆”一个好孩子,这种_______的做法会让许多孩子生出问题来。填入画横线部分最恰当的一项是:
如果剩余价值率不变,影响年剩余价值量的因素有
下列关于OSPF协议的描述中,错误的是()。
Ifyou’regoingtobesuccessfulinmanagingyourownbusiness,you’vegottolearnto______yourself.
最新回复
(
0
)